Copper Miners Strike - Calumet, Michigan, USA. Industrial action by Copper Miners of the Western Federation of Miners. Workers were concerned of being displaced to a lower-paying job or of losing otheir job altogether with the advent of the one-man drills. Strikers here stand outside Dunn's Bar, a favourite among miners. Just next door to Dunn's was the No. 203 local WFM office.
